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,321,916,270
Lastest Block:
1,957,535
Utxos:
1,983,534
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
29/08/2025 19:15:28 UTC
Txid
27e0dc35b1e97548fa038382d9f8487604558c3a2b436d027b126dada8383bec
Block
1,843,709
Block hash
d2ed92217344e165d63cf3cc1100524473c70583d9db616c5321a5929bda916c
Stake amount
292.38216294 XEP
Sender
ep1q8jr99lnhu3ncrz5ca0zzg50xwd0f7afxs7rnnp
Recipient
ep1q70trx85m48pas76ep9prmcc7wjunmlm2v6sjz7
(5,100,390.7379635 XEP)